Nottingham Trent University accredited by ILAM
Nottingham Trent University’s BSc (Hons) sports science and management degree has become the first undergraduate programme in the UK to be accredited by the Institute of Leisure and Amenity Management (ILAM) at Advanced Diploma level.
This accreditation means that graduates are now able to claim exemptions from ILAM when choosing to take their diploma or advanced diploma courses in the future.
The degree combines elements of management and leadership with real-life experience in a variety of sport and leisure organisations.
Students produce assignments based on briefs set by industry professionals and benefit from visits to organisations and talks from leading managers and consultants.
Senior lecturer Chris Parker said: “It’s great to receive recognition and status from such an influential body as ILAM. We have worked hard to ensure that our students have many opportunities to put management theory into practice in the real world.” Details: +44 (0)115 848 2650 or www.ntu.ac.uk
